What is the cheapest month to fly from Sydney to the Dominican Republic?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Sydney to the Dominican Republic,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Sydney to the Dominican Republic is April, when tickets cost $2,163 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are June and August, when the average cost of return tickets is $3,079 and $2,890 respectively.

  • What is the cheapest time of day to fly to the Dominican Republic?

    The cheapest time of day to fly to the Dominican Republic is generally in the evening, when retur flights cost $2,607 on average. Morning departures are around 7% more expensive than evening flights, on average. The most expensive time of day to fly to the Dominican Republic is generally in the afternoon, which is peak travel time and where the average cost of a ticket is $3,059.
